Buying Guide for Coffee Makers with Water Line Hookup

Choosing the best coffee maker that hooks up directly to a water line involves evaluating several critical factors to suit your lifestyle and space. Here are some key considerations:

Water Connection Compatibility

  • Direct Water Line Feature: Confirm if the coffee maker is designed for or can be professionally installed to connect to a water line to avoid frequent refills.
  • Installation Requirements: Some machines need plumbing kits or adapter parts; check compatibility with your home or office water system.

Coffee Capacity and Usage

  • Cup Size: Choose a machine that aligns with your coffee consumption – from single-serve models to large 14-cup batches.
  • Batch Settings: Models with small batch options save water and coffee when brewing less quantity.

Programming and Convenience

  • Programmable Timers: Schedule brewing to have hot coffee ready when you want it.
  • Auto Pause and Brew Pause: Allows removing a cup mid-brew without spills.
  • Easy Cleaning Features: Removable water reservoirs, dishwasher-safe parts, and reusable filters enhance convenience.

Build Quality and Materials

  • Carafe Material: Borosilicate glass carafes resist odor and maintain coffee temperature.
  • Filter Options: Permanent filters reduce waste, but paper filters may be used for preference.
  • Durability: Stainless steel and high-quality plastics ensure long-lasting performance.

Additional Features

  • Brewing Technology: Features like blooming or showerhead brewing improve flavor extraction.
  • Strength and Temperature Controls: Customize coffee strength and maintain ideal serving temperatures.
  • Space Considerations: Compact or under-cabinet-compatible designs optimize kitchen counter space.
